Poured steps installation involves creating durable, smooth concrete staircases directly poured into place on your property. This service typically includes preparing the site, forming the shape of the stairs, and pouring concrete to form a sturdy, seamless set of steps. The process allows for customization in size, shape, and finish, ensuring the final result complements the property's aesthetic and functional needs. Poured steps are often chosen for their clean appearance and long-lasting performance, making them a practical solution for both residential and commercial properties.
This service helps address common problems associated with traditional stair materials such as wood or stone, including cracking, uneven surfaces, and ongoing maintenance. For properties with uneven terrain or deteriorating existing stairs, poured steps can provide a level, stable, and visually appealing solution. They are also effective for creating accessible entryways, reducing tripping hazards, and improving overall safety around entrances, patios, or garden pathways. The overview below groups typical Poured Steps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or poured steps repairs or patchwork gener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work needed.
Standard Installation - Installing new poured steps for a standard-sized entryway usually costs between $1,200 and $3,000. Larger or more complex projects can reach $4,000+ but are less common.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ire set of poured steps often falls in the $3,500-$7,000 range. Many projects in this category stay within the middle to upper end, with more extensive jobs reaching higher costs.
Custom or Complex Projects - Highly customized or intricate poured step installations can exceed $7,000, though these are less frequent.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ific design and site requ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are poured steps used for? Poured steps are typically used to create durable, smooth outdoor staircases or landings in patios, gardens, or walkways.
What materials are commonly used for poured steps? They are usually made from concrete, which can be finished with various textures and colors to match the surrounding environment.
Can poured steps be customized to fit specific designs? Yes, local contractors can customize poured steps in size, shape, and finish to suit different aesthetic and functional needs.
Are poured steps suitable for all types of terrain? Poured steps can be adapted for various terrains, but it's best to consult local service providers to determine suitability for specific sites.
How do local contractors prepare for pouring steps? They typically assess the site, prepare the foundation, set forms, and ensure proper reinforcement before pouring the concrete.
